Ringo is a young, large mixed breed dog with Shepherd and Collie in his lineage and a striking tricolor coat of brown, black, and white. He is neutered, house trained, and vaccinated. Ringo is currently in Longview, TX, and brings a blend of athleticism, loyalty, and affection to any home.

Questions about Ringo

  • What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?

    Ringo, with his Shepherd/Collie mix background, will thrive in homes where he gets plenty of attention and inclusion in daily activities. These breeds do well in houses with space to roam and families who are engaged with their pets.

  • How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?

    As a Shepherd/Collie mix, Ringo benefits from a yard or accessible outdoor space where he can play and explore. While daily walks and activity are key, he adjusts well as long as he's exercised and included.

  •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?

    Ringo's nature suits homes with respectful children, ideally over the age of 10. Shepherd and Collie breeds are usually gentle and loyal, making them good companions for families.
